2-Quinoxalinone Usage And Synthesis

Chemical PropertiesWhite to yellow to light brown solid
Uses2-Quinoxalinone is a metabolite of Quinalphos, and is known to photocatalytically destroy antioxidant vitamins and biogenic amines in vitro and is genotoxic to both light- and dark-exposed bacteria.
DefinitionChEBI: A hydroxyquinoxaline that consists of quinoxaline having a single hydroxy substituent located at position 2.
General DescriptionEpitaxial crystallization of syndiotactic polypropylene on 2-quinoxalinol yields isochiral form II of syndiotactic polypropylene. 2-Quinoxalinol participates in direct dehydrative cross-coupling of 2-quinoxalinone with p-tolylacetylene via Pd/Cu-catalyzed phosphonium coupling.
